City Council Decision

City Council on May 14 and 15, 2019, adopted the following:  

 

1. City Council assume the services installed within Goldthread Terrace and Wingstem Court and that the City formally assume the roads within the Registered Plan of Subdivision 66M-2507.

 

2. City Council authorize the Director, Engineering Review to release the performance guarantee held with respect to the municipal services in accordance with the Subdivision Agreement.

 

3. City Council direct that an assumption By-law be prepared to assume the public highway and municipal services within the Registered Subdivision Plan 66M-2507.

 

4. City Council authorize and direct the City Solicitor to register the assumption By-law in the Land Registry Office, at the expense of the Owner.

 

5. City Council authorize the appropriate City Officials to take the necessary action to give effect to City Council's decision.

 

6. City Council authorize the appropriate City Officials to transfer ownership of the street lighting system constructed with Registered Plan of Subdivision 66M-2507 to Toronto Hydro.

Summary

This report requests Council's authority for the City to assume the municipal roads and services within Goldthread Terrace and Wingstem Court, in accordance with the terms of the Subdivision Agreement for Plan 66M-2507, registered on November 12, 2012 between Arista Homes (North York) Inc. and the City of Toronto.
